Transaction f66683507ea2ef93b8affca5aad27e26906b60aa55839dad8a9b6cc1825b97e0
1 Input
1 Output
-
f66683507ea2ef93b8affca5aad27e26906b60aa55839dad8a9b6cc1825b97e0:0
- value
- 11178652
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dab531613f8908e36b7538742592164d5f64b6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CTUhpRTjSKb5VnCSjdfG3PtPWtiNYJbZD